1. Standard Deletion via Mi Video: Why Files Stay in Memory
The most obvious way to remove it from the app interface is not as users expect it to work. When you click "Delete" in Mi Video, the file is:
- β Disappears from the app gallery
- β not removed from the internal storage device or SD-map
- π Moves to the.trash folder (if the basket is included in the box) MIUI)
- π It is in the original directory (for example, DCIM/Camera or downloads)
To completely erase the video, after deleting it in Mi Video, you must:
- Open Files β Categories β Video (standard file manager Xiaomi).
- Find the folder where the file was stored (usually DCIM, Movies, or WhatsApp/Media).
- Delete the video from there manually (long press β "Delete").

Files displayed in Mi Video can be stored in different folders depending on the source:
| Source video | Typical storage path | Can I remove it without consequences? |
|---|---|---|
| Smartphone camera | DCIM/Camera or DCIM/100ANDRO | β Yes. |
| Downloads from the browser | Download or Downloads | β Yes. |
| Messages (WhatsApp, Telegram) | WhatsApp/Media/WhatsApp VideoTelegram/Telegram Video | β οΈ Unless you need to write. |
| Cash Mi Video | Android/data/com.miui.videoplayer/cache | β Yes (clears temporary files) |
| Screencasts (screen recording) | Movies/ScreenRecords or Pictures/Screenshots | β Yes. |
To find all the videos on the device:
- Open the Files app (Blue folder icon).
- Go to the Category section β Video.
- Click on the three dots in the top right β Sort β By size to see the heaviest files.
- Select unnecessary videos with a long press β Delete.
β οΈ Note: If the video is stored on SD-Before you delete the card, remove it from your phone and check it on your PC. Some files may be hidden due to file system errors. exFAT/FAT32.
3.Cache cleaning Mi Video: why the app "weighs" gigabytes
The Mi Video app actively caches videos you've watched, especially if you're watching high-resolution (1080p/4K) videos. The cache can take anywhere from 500MB to 3-5GB, even if the original files have already been deleted.
Open Settings β Applications β Application Management
Find "Video" (com.miui.videoplayer) in the list
Press the Warehouse β Clear the cache
Reboot the phone (optional)
Check the vacant space in the settings β The phone. β Memory.-->
On MIUI 14/15, cache can be stored in two places:
- π Android/data/com.miui.videoplayer/cache β flash-file.
- π Android/data/com.miui.videoplayer/files β thumbnails and metadata.
- π MIUI/video/thumb β Video sketches (hidden folder).
If after cleaning the cache the place is not freed, check the folder MIUI/video/thumb. There may be thousands of miniatures in it. 10β50 CB each, which is totaled 100β300 MB: You can only remove them through root access or ADB-team:
adb shell rm -rf /sdcard/MIUI/video/thumb/*β οΈ Note: Deleting the thumb folder will cause all videos in Mi Video to temporarily appear without previews.
4.Remove video via Xiaomi Cloud: how to erase duplicates
If your Xiaomi has sync enabled with Xiaomi Cloud, videos can automatically upload to the cloud, even if you have deleted them locally.
- Open your Settings β Xiaomi Account β Mi Cloud.
- Select Gallery or Files (depending on the version of MIUI).
- Find the video section and highlight unnecessary files.
- Click Remove β Confirm the action.
Important nuances:
- π Files deleted from the cloud are not automatically deleted from your phone (and vice versa).
- π₯ If the video was uploaded to the cloud in its original quality, the copy can weigh 2-3 times more than the optimized version on the phone.
- β³ Files in the cloud bin are stored for 10 days (as opposed to 30 days in the local basket). MIUI).

5. Recovery of accidentally deleted videos
If you deleted the video by mistake, there are several ways to return it:
Method 1: MIUI basket
As mentioned earlier, MIUI has a built-in recycle bin where files are stored for 30 days.
- Open the Files β Recycle Bin.
- Find the desired video (you can sort by date of deletion).
- Press the file. β Restore.
Method 2: Recovery programs
If the cart is cleaned, try utilities like DiskDigger or Recuva (for PC).
- π Do not write new files to your phone after deleting them β they can overwrite deleted data.
- π± Root rights will be required to scan internal memory.
- πΎ Nana SD-The chances of recovery are higher (up to 70%) than in internal memory (20β30%).
Method 3: Backups of Google Photos
If you have synced with Google Photos:
- Open the Google Photos app.
- Go to the Recycle Bin (files are stored there for 60 days).
- Restore the video β it will reappear in Mi Video after sync.

6. Reset Mi Video settings: if the application "gluts"
If after deleting the video continues to appear in Mi Video or the application does not update the gallery, reset its settings:
- Go to Settings β Applications β Application Management.
- Find the video (com.miui.videoplayer) and open its page.
- Click Storage β Reset settings (not to be confused with Clear Data!).
- Reboot the phone.
It's an action:
- β Resets sorting and player settings.
- β Forced to update the media base MIUI.
- β It won't delete the video files.
